320102115 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 512163408. Its totient is φ = 170721120.

The previous prime is 320102089. The next prime is 320102131. The reversal of 320102115 is 511201023.

It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 320102115 - 26 = 320102051 is a prime.

It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(15), and also a Moran number because the ratio is a prime number: 21340141 = 320102115 / (3 + 2 + 0 + 1 + 0 + 2 + 1 + 1 + 5).

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 320102094 and 320102103.

It is an unprimeable number.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 10670056 + ... + 10670085.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(64020426).

Almost surely, 2320102115 is an apocalyptic number.

320102115 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(192061293).

320102115 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

320102115 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 21340149.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 60, while the sum is 15.

The square root of 320102115 is about 17891.3977933531. The cubic root of 320102115 is about 684.0631268471.

Adding to 320102115 its reverse (511201023), we get a palindrome (831303138).

The spelling of 320102115 in words is "three hundred twenty million, one hundred two thousand, one hundred fifteen".

Divisors: 1 3 5 15 21340141 64020423 106700705 320102115
